Explanations of attachment: Learning theory

?
What is learning theory?
All behaviours are learned rather than inherited
1 of 7
What is classical conditioning?
New conditioned response learned through association learned through a neutral stimulus and an unconditioned stimulus
2 of 7
Stimulus of classical conditioning
Food UCS - pleasure UCR. Mum NS - No response. NS + UCS paired. NS is now CS - pleasure CR
3 of 7
What is operant conditioning ?
The reduction of discomfort created by hunger is rewarding so food becomes a primary reinforce, associated with mother who becomes secondary reinforcer
4 of 7
Explain Operant conditioning?
Food becomes the primary reinforcer because it supplies the reward, i.e reinforces the behaviour that avoids discomfort
5 of 7
What is social learning?
Children model the parents attachment behaviours
6 of 7
EVALUATION: Learning theory is based on research with animals
Animal studies lack external validity because they are not humans
